Order Clerks salary by percentile in Delaware
BLS-reported salary distribution — from entry-level (10th percentile) to top earners (90th percentile).
Order Clerks in Delaware earn a median salary of $41,430 per year ($3,452/month).
This is 8.5% below the national average of $45,281.
Delaware ranks #40 out of 48 states for Order Clerks pay.
Approximately 170 people work in this occupation across Delaware.
Salaries increased by 4.2% compared to 2024.
About This Job: Order Clerks
Receive and process incoming orders for materials, merchandise, classified ads, or services such as repairs, installations, or rental of facilities. Generally receives orders via mail, phone, fax, or other electronic means. Duties include informing customers of receipt, prices, shipping dates, and delays; preparing contracts; and handling complaints.

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2025 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.
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
